3607101440 has 100 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 8858369784. Its totient is φ = 1409286144.
The previous prime is 3607101427. The next prime is 3607101529. The reversal of 3607101440 is 441017063.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×36071014402 = 26022361596900147200, which contains 22 as substring.
It is a nialpdrome in base 16.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 83886059 + ... + 83886101.
Almost surely, 23607101440 is an apocalyptic number.
3607101440 is a droll number since its even prime factors and its odd prime factors have the same sum.
It is an amenable number.
It is a practical number, because each smaller number is the sum of distinct divisors of 3607101440, and also a Zumkeller number, because its divisors can be partitioned in two sets with the same sum (4429184892).
3607101440 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(5251268344).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
3607101440 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
3607101440 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 96 (or 50 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2016, while the sum is 26.
The square root of 3607101440 is about 60059.1495111278. The cubic root of 3607101440 is about 1533.6259622131.
The spelling of 3607101440 in words is "three billion, six hundred seven million, one hundred one thousand, four hundred forty".
